Magee of Donegal is a clothing manufacturer and retailer based in Donegal, a town located in the south of County Donegal in the Province of Ulster in Ireland. The company is best known for their Donegal tweed, but also manufactures items from linen, wool and other materials. The company traces its origins to 1866,[1] when the founder, John Magee, opened a clothing shop in Donegal Town. The company has supplied cloth for the uniforms of Ireland's state airline, Aer Lingus.
